Did you know that depending on your skin color, eczema can look different — and possibly lead to misdiagnosis?
In this episode, Dr. Shawn Kwatra, Director of the Johns Hopkins Itch Center, returns to explain how eczema symptoms vary across different skin tones. We cover why redness isn’t a reliable sign of inflammation in darker skin, how eczema may mimic psoriasis in people of color, and new research on itch severity and diagnosis.
